Tigers Lose to Sea Eagles in Brisbane

The Wests Tigers faced a tough defeat against the Manly Sea Eagles, ending the match 46-18 at Suncorp Stadium during the Magic Round.

Benji Marshall's team fell behind by 18 points early and found it challenging to regroup. Despite showing moments of strength and individual brilliance, the situation worsened when they were down to 12 players midway through the second half, allowing Manly to take full advantage.

Notably, Alex Seyfarth celebrated his 100th match with the Wests Tigers, while rookie Ethan Roberts made a strong impression in his NRL debut.
